Capability leapfrogging in the Japanese IT services industry

Hiroshi Tsuji, Akito Sakurai, Amrit Tiwana

Research output: Chapter in Book/Report/Conference proceedingConference contribution

Abstract

The focal question that we address is about how firms transition their IT product capabilities to the IT services capabilities. In particular, we were interested in exploring the unexpected observation that some incumbent firms in the Japanese IT industry were able to leapfrog capability development for transitioning to the IT services model, while others struggled to do so. We use a multi-method approach consisting of four complementary stages for addressing the research question: (a) multiple case studies in eleven leading Japanese IT firms, (b) a large scale survey of division managers in 208 firms in Japan, (c) quantitative sequence analysis of archival product development logs for over 1,800 IT products in 208 Japanese firms during the ongoing transition, and (d) a Monte Carlo simulation of a subset of the insights obtained in the preceding stages.
